Antioxidant and anti-inflammatory. Inhibits the phosphorylation of mitogen-activated protein kinase MEK. Suppresses the expression of matrix metalloproteinases (MMP) 1, 3 and 9, that are involved in the breakdown of the extracellular matrix during tumor metastasis. Suppresses NF-κB transcriptional activation, nitric oxide (NO) and PGE2 production, inducible nitric oxide synthase (iNOS; NOS II) and cyclooxygenase-2 (COX-2) expression.
